While pulse oximetry is effective in detecting hypoxemia, it is insufficient for identifying hyperoxia when SpO₂ exceeds 97%, often necessitating invasive arterial blood gas analysis. The Oxygen Reserve Index (ORI) is a noninvasive, real-time monitoring parameter reflecting moderate hyperoxic ranges (PaO₂ 100-200 mmHg) and provides early warning of oxygenation changes before SpO₂ alterations occur. Combined use of ORI and pulse oximetry may enable optimal oxygen titration and prevention of both hypoxemia and hyperoxemia.\n\nLaparoscopic nephrectomy is widely performed due to its clinical advantages. By providing continuous, noninvasive assessment of oxygen reserve in the hyperoxic range, ORi may offer an earlier warning of oxygen depletion before peripheral oxygen saturation declines. The study compares time to reventilation thresholds, arterial blood gas parameters, and perioperative respiratory outcomes between ORi-guided and standard SpO₂-guided monitoring strategies.",[53,54,55],"Apneic Oxygenation","Endolarengeal Surgery","Oxygen Reserve Index",[57,58,59],"oxygen reserve index","pulse oximetry","apneic ventilation","2026-02-15",{"date":62,"type":32},"2026-02-17",{"date":64,"type":22},"2026-01-27",{"date":66,"type":22},"2026-03-25",{"name":68,"class":69},"Istanbul University","OTHER",1,{"id":72,"slug":73,"hasResults":11,"nctId":74,"briefTitle":75,"officialTitle":76,"acronym":4,"eligibilityCriteria":77,"healthyVolunteers":11,"sex":17,"minAge":18,"maxAge":78,"enrollmentInfo":79,"targetDuration":4,"studyType":48,"phases":81,"briefSummary":82,"conditions":83,"keywords":4,"overallStatus":28,"whyStopped":4,"lastUpdateSubmitDate":88,"lastUpdatePostDateStruct":89,"startDateStruct":91,"completionDateStruct":93,"leadSponsor":95,"locationsCount":4},"100621788","ori-guided-fio-titration-in-prone-spine-surgery-impact-on-postoperative-atelectasis-assessed-by-lung-ultrasound-100621788","NCT07375173","ORI-Guided FiO₂ Titration in Prone Spine Surgery: Impact on Postoperative Atelectasis Assessed by Lung Ultrasound","Oxygen Reserve Index-Guided FiO₂ Titration in Prone Spine Surgery: Impact on Postoperative Atelectasis Assessed by Lung Ultrasound","Inclusion Criteria:\n\n1. ORI can provide early warnings of deteriorating oxygenation before changes are reflected in SpO₂ levels.
